Minutes — Management Meeting, Factory Capacity Decision

For the finance team: management reviewed utilisation at the Grellwick plant, currently at 94%. Options discussed were a second shift or a line extension. Decision: proceed with the second shift from March; capex for the extension deferred one year. Finance to model labour cost impact by month-end. The confidential planning context follows below.

board note of bawep-tajef: Queniusek Systems plans to raise the Quenvan list price by 53.1 percent in March. The pricing group signed off on a budget of $176.4 million for Project Drueth. The renewal with Casionix Partners closes at $142.5 million a year, 8.3 percent below the last contract. Project Fraax slips by six weeks because of the tooling delay.

Minutes — Management Meeting, Possible Acquisition of Brindlewick Tools. Attendees from Solvane Holdings discussed early-stage talks with Brindlewick's owners. Consensus: the fit is good, the price less so. Diligence access was agreed in principle, with a small deal team to be stood up quietly. No external advisers engaged yet. The board is asked to keep this strictly within the room; further detail is in the confidential note below.

management briefing: Project Ulavan slips by two quarters because of the staffing delay.

**Ticket BREW-412: Signature check fails under hermetic build**

So the Quillforge migration to our hermetic build system (Tinderbox) broke artifact verification — the sandbox strips the ambient keyring, so the verifier sees no trusted keys and bails. Future maintainers: don't "fix" this by disabling verification again. The right move is pinning the key explicitly in the build manifest. For reference, the key Tinderbox should trust is this one.

rollout seal: bky4_x7Gc

**Q: Does the Bramblehold admin dashboard support dark mode?**

A: Yes, since release 4.2. Dark mode is driven entirely by the Duskline theme tokens; components should never branch on a theme flag directly. If a panel renders incorrectly in dark mode, the usual cause is a hardcoded color that bypassed the token layer — fix the token usage rather than adding an override. Contrast requirements apply to both themes. Token definitions, theming rules, and known exceptions are documented on the page below.

dashboard of yahaf-kajep = https://jira.zemvarsys.internal/display/projects/browse/browse/a08b